The American fashion system is all levels of value. A woman knows when she's buying champagne and when she's buying soda pop. It's two different markets. But why shouldn't a woman have the right to drink Coca-Cola when she feels like it and champagne when she wants to? That's the American way.
The fashion illustrator, married to Isabel Toledo, explains his misgivings with the proposed Design Piracy Protection Act, which would provide partial copyright protection to designers
